This cartoon, which debuted at 10:00 Saturday morning in 1982 on ABC, is an example of evolution gone horribly wrong.

"The Mork & Mindy / Laverne & Shirley / Fonz Hour" has it's origins back in 1980 with one of my all-time favorite time travel epics, The Fonz & The Happy Day Gang", which was then joined in 1982 by the swine-tinted Laverne & Shirley In The Army. Having had a fairly successful run at adapting sit-coms for Saturday mornings, the unholy trinity of Hanna-Barbera, Ruby-Spears AND Paramount Entertainment combined their forces to create... this.

First, they mashed Laverne & Shirley together with The Fonz, taking away the whole time-travel aspect and instead making it the story of an Army Base (with a pig for a drill sergeant) where a leather-jacket hoodlum on a motorcycle and his talking dog are allowed to com and hang out. This is where I refused to continue suspending my disbelief. Talking military pige, time-traveling greasers, yeah, I can get behind that. But civilian hoodlums allowed on base for no particular reason? NO.

And then there's the Mork cartoon. It's the same basic premise of the Mork & Mindy sit-com (alien sent to Earth in order to learn their customs and report back to his superiors), only Mork is a teen-ager. ANd he has a wacky alien dog because this *is* 1982 Hanna-Barbera and EVERYBODY GETS DOGS!!!
